About Frontier Airlines
Destinations: 60 in the U.S., five in Mexico, one in Costa Rica and one in Canada. Flights: 350 daily departures systemwide. Fleet: 62 aircraft, including two Airbus 320s, 49 Airbus A319s and 11 Airbus A318s. Subsidiary Lynx Aviation has 10 Bombardier Q400s.
Passengers: About 12 million annually. Employees: About 6,000, including more than 710 pilots, more than 1,040 flight attendants and more than 300 mechanics. Subsidiaries and partners: Subsidiary Lynx Aviation and regional partner RepublicFrontier together fly to 16 regional destinations under the Frontier name. Frontier also offers flights to 35 regional destinations under a codeshare agreement with Great Lakes Aviation. Hub: Denver International Airport. Headquarters: Denver.
